Ottawa �muzzling� scientists, panel tells global research community
$1:
For almost three weeks after David Tarasick published findings about one of the largest ozone holes ever discovered above the Arctic, the federal scientist was barred from breathing a word about it to the media.
Kristi Miller was similarly gagged from granting interviews about her own research into a virus that might be killing British Columbia�s wild sockeye salmon, despite going to print in the prestigious journal Science.
...
�It�s pretty clear that for federal scientists, Ottawa decides now if the researchers can talk, what they can talk about and when they can say it,� senior science journalist Margaret Munro, with Postmedia News, told a group gathered at the American Association for the Advancement of Science annual meeting.
�We�re not talking about state secrets here.�
